Yesterday afternoon, Lee and I were talking about tomorrow's show with deejay Trevor Fought when Lee pointed out that Janis and I are both from the Golden Triangle. And I've been surprised at how often I'm compared to her, both in live performance and in the reviews. My curiosity finally got the best of me about a year ago, and I decided I had to learn more about the alienated, enigmatic girl from Port Arthur who managed to leave her imprint on this world forever in a fleeting twenty-seven years. So I read the biography by Myra Friedman. Truth is, it is an amazing and inspirational story of what the great Martin Luther King, Jr. called "making a way out of no way," and there was so much more to this American hero than what most people realize.
